Output ec68ea485ece92d65c352962b0876bb7d3814ac21f4f18be2e82e2b269f187ad:0

value
42471916014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55fa5d955fe08e53bc9b1e13e01ae4d0d5e16a0e OP_EQUAL
address
39XdHZ44m97dV5AaReC7HXVK9JNSU93Eyd
transaction
ec68ea485ece92d65c352962b0876bb7d3814ac21f4f18be2e82e2b269f187ad
spent
true